    @DerOrk ปีที่แล้ว +2

    Combat is not gonna get remotely as 'wacky' and diverse as Wasteland 3. You've seen most of it propably in terms of weapons and abilities allready. I think Wasteland 3 tried to ape the success of the Divinity Games, Wasteland 2 on the other hand deliberately keeps things more grounded, and leans considerably more towards simulator and survival genres. There are very few active abilities ( "spells" ) and munition is a LOT rarer but in return more lethal. Combat in WL2 is a lot more about resource management, depending on how far you're in the game you'll might have allready noticed that having even a single full magazine is not a given, and your limited back pack space means you'll have to think what you'll bring with you on your expeditions.
    Personally, I hade a dedicated mule, a character that was really terrible at fighting, didn't even carry a real weapon, but had a lot of inventory space and was tasked with re-supplying the other party members in firefights. It was fun and refreshing playing around such a support / utility character.

    @vyvexthorne ปีที่แล้ว +1

    One fun thing about W2 is that it exports your characters at the end of the game so you essentially can get a NG+ mode by importing your end game squad when starting a new game. This allows you to go through and do any quests you missed or messed up from maybe not having enough skill and play the game on supreme jerk without it actually being as tough. . You can do this over and over as every time you hit the end game it'll export your characters at that level. I was really hoping they'd add this feature to W3 but it doesn't look like they will.

    @ulroxvladtepes4023 ปีที่แล้ว

    Wasteland 2 directors cut is actually a pretty good game. The initial game wasn't the best, and not all what inXile promised, but they eventually delivered on their promise. Wasteland 2 though holds a very special place in my heart, not because the game is something special, because it's not all that special. It holds a special place because it literally started the whole 'kickstarted old school rpg' thing. Before wasteland 2, the whole rpg landscape had grown incredible stale, and brian fargo, in his kickstarter video for wasteland 2, managed to channel his frustrations out on how the publishers had treated him, because he wanted to build an oldskool game, and everyone had turned him down. They had looked at the success of the double fine kickstarter, and they managed to become successful in making the kickstarter, afterwards pillars of eternity followed suit with obsidian, torment tides of numenera, divinity original sin, and a whole lot of the amazing cprg developers managed to enter, and was reinvigorated, partly due to brian fargo's influence, and that original kickstarter pitch video, which is still worth a watch to this day. InXile is a company I am very grateful for, because it has Brian fargo, who has been partly responsible for so many good games over the years, and had a hugely positive impact on the whole gaming industry, as he was the former ceo of interplay productions. I would argue that without wasteland 2, there would not have been the same interest in pillars of eternity, owlcat may not have made pathfinder, divinity might not have happened in the way it did. We have a lot to be thankful for here.
